    23、version 15.0.0 Release 151 Scope The present document defines Management Object (MO) that is used to configure the UE with parameters related to Application specific Congestion control for Data Communication (ACDC) functionality. The MO is compatible with the OMA Device Management (DM) protocol spec

    24、ifications, version 1.2 and upwards, and is defined using the OMA DM Device Description Framework (DDF) as described in the Enabler Release Definition OMA-ERELD-DM-V1_2 3. The MO consists of relevant parameters for provisioning of ACDC at a UE. 2 References The following documents contain provisions

    31、.0.0 Release 154 ACDC MO The ACDC MO is used to manage configuration parameters related to ACDC functionality for a UE supporting provisioning of such information. The presence and format of the ACDC configuration file on the USIM is specified in 3GPP TS 31.102 5. The MO identifier is: urn:oma:mo:ex

    32、t-3gpp-ACDC-config:1.0. The OMA DM Access Control List (ACL) property mechanism (see OMA-ERELD-DM-V1_2 3) may be used to grant or deny access rights to OMA DM servers in order to modify nodes and leaf objects of the ACDC MO.     44、n identifier. - Occurrence: One - Format: chr - Access Types: Get, Replace - Values: Further definition of the format of the OS specific application identifier is beyond the scope of this specification. 5.4.13 /ACDC/ACDCConf/ACDCCategory The ACDCCategory leaf represents indicates the ACDC category f

    45、or which applications matching the ApplicationInfo belongs. - Occurrence: One - Format: int - Access Types: Get, Replace - Values: The ACDC category indicates the category to which the identified application belongs. Table 5.4.13 gives the decode of the ACDC category. The highest ranked ACDC categor

    46、y means the ACDC category with the lowest value and a UE treats applications assigned to the highest ranked ACDC category as the least restriction to access attempts. The lowest ranked ACDC category means the ACDC category with the highest value and a UE treats applications assigned to the lowest ra

    47、nked ACDC category as the most restriction to access attempts. Table 5.4.13: Values of ACDC category Value Description 0 Reserved 1 Highest ranked ACDC category value 2-15 ACDC category value indicating descending order of ranking 16 Lowest ranked ACDC category value ETSI ETSI TS 124 105 V15.0.0 (20
